Aug 13, 2023 · Xin PengWent to buy a bike after talking to the owner on FB marketplace. I got there at the time which we had agreed on several days before and found out that the rear brake had broken during a test ride and still needed to be fixed. I sat there for over an hour as this happened, and noticed that it wasn't shifting correctly when I tested it. I was told this would be fixed by spraying WD-40 in the problem shifter and/or cleaning it. It did not fix that, but I was assured it would if I waited.I took the bike home, and then upon further use and inspection found that: both derailleurs were misaligned, causing constant chain skips under load, the front shifter was completely destroyed (she sprayed it with WD-40 and said to wait for that to fix it, which it did not), the rear wheel had nipples that were stripped and had to be replaced to true the wheel, the rear cassette was worn and needed to be replaced, and the chain was stretched enough to need to be replaced.If this had been said up front, I wouldn't have had much of a problem; I got the bike for cheap and it was otherwise what I wanted. But it was advertised as "refurbished", with the description saying "any worn parts have been replaced for years of riding enjoyment". A non-functional worn-down shifter, chain, and nipples were not replaced, and needed to be for long term use.I like the mission of the business, but the problem with having under-or-unpaid trainees/apprentices doing work is that things like this get through. The long wait to fix something on a bike which the owner had advance warning would be sold (and agreed to the pick up time on) combined with the unsatisfactory state of the bike itself really soured me.If I need a cheap frame for a project, fine, but a functional 'buy it and ride away without a thought' bike this was not.
